The Ranger® VS1682SC is designed to tame swells and rough water like a big deep V, but in a shorter size that’s long on legendary Ranger quality. The VS1682SC has a wealth of features built in from the factory that offer unmatched on-the-water comfort, control and performance. Power trim at the console and bow, hydraulic steering, aerated livewells fore and aft and a single fiberglass console are just a few of the standard niceties. From there, a host of options are available to precisely suit your needs. Regardless of how you outfit your VS1682SC, the wide beam offers rock-like stability and ample workspace to play fish and rig gear while the deeper V hull is designed to keep you dry and riding smooth in big water. In lieu of a passenger console, the SC has a storage box in its place. Cavernous storage for tackle and huge wells for live bait ensure that you won’t ever be short on gear, while a 25-gallon fuel tank will keep you trolling for hours. Rated up to 115 horsepower, the VS1682SC punches well above its weight — which at roughly 1,500 pounds is easy to tow as well.
